WebDuring S-phase the DNA is replicated and this results in two chromatin fibers (known as sister chromatids). However, these chromatin fibers are attached to each other at the centromere and together they make up a post S-phase chromosome. WebPhases of the cell cycle. Phases G1, S, and G2 comprise interphases of the cell cycle. M (mitosis) comprises 4 distinct phases: prophase, metaphase, anaphase, and telophase. G0 is the resting phase where cells exist in a quiescent, non-dividing state. WebInterphase consists of three stages: first gap (G1), synthesis (S) and second gap (G2). WebMitosis consists of four basic phases: prophase, metaphase, anaphase, and telophase. Some textbooks list five, breaking prophase into an early phase (called prophase) and a late phase (called prometaphase).
